Changelog

Historique du portail

Cette page synthétise les évolutions du portail Galactic-Shrine Standards et des packs principaux. Elle permet de suivre d’un coup d’œil les grandes itérations du site et les versions des standards publiés.

v2.7.2 Version actuelle du portail
v1.2.0 Pack Documentation harmonisé
v1.0.0 Pack Codage harmonisé
Chronologie

Évolution du portail

Une vue plus visuelle que le simple README, pour repérer les jalons majeurs du site.

v2.7.2

Thème sombre/lumineux et structuration SCSS

Ajout d’un système de thème Sombre/Lumineux avec persistance de la préférence utilisateur, ainsi qu’une première structuration des styles en SCSS pour mieux organiser les variables, la base, le layout et les composants du portail.

Theme switch Sombre/Lumineux SCSS Refactor CSS
v2.7.1

Raffinements structurels et éditoriaux

Nettoyage des pages système et éditoriales, enrichissement du changelog, harmonisation du layout, ajout de macros réutilisables et mise à jour des assets d’icônes.

Refactor README Changelog Roadmap Favicons
v2.7.0

Migration Eleventy

Passage à un générateur statique avec layouts, données structurées, pages générées et pipeline de build unifié.

Eleventy Layouts Build unifié
v2.6.0

Roadmap visuelle assortie

Ajout d’une page Roadmap cohérente avec le changelog, intégrée à la navigation, au footer, au sitemap et à l’index du portail.

Roadmap Navigation Sitemap
v2.5.0

About + changelog + domaine personnalisé

Ajout d’une page “About Galactic-Shrine Standards”, d’un changelog visuel dédié et de la pré-intégration du domaine personnalisé.

About Changelog Custom domain
v2.3.0

Nettoyage UX + libellés FR

Suppression des éléments inutiles du header, francisation des libellés visibles et allègement de la navigation.

Français UX Navigation
v2.2.0

Logo réel et favicon dérivé

Intégration du vrai logo Galactic-Shrine dans le header, puis génération d’un favicon cohérent à partir du visuel GS fourni.

Logo PNG Favicon Header
v2.1.0

Alignement sur la palette du site

Le thème a été recalé sur l’ambiance visuelle du site réel : fond violet profond, panneaux violets et accents verts d’action.

Palette site Header/Footer Contraste
v2.0.0

Portail premium

Ajout des pages HTML lisibles pour chaque standard, d’une navigation plus sérieuse et de la recherche côté client.

Pages HTML Recherche Navigation
v1.0.0

Starter GitHub Pages

Mise en place du portail statique, de la structure du dépôt, des pages d’accueil et de la publication GitHub Pages.

Starter GitHub Pages ZIP intégrés
Historique technique récent

Post-migration Eleventy

Cette section suit les commits récents du dépôt après la bascule vers Eleventy, afin de conserver une trace plus fidèle de l’évolution réelle du repo.

17 mars 2026

1a5d9c9 — Migration du site vers Eleventy

Refonte structurelle du portail avec source src/, layouts partagés, assets réorganisés et génération du site vers _site/.

Eleventy Layouts Build
17 mars 2026

ae25985 — Configuration Eleventy et workflow GitHub Pages

Mise en place de la configuration de build et de la chaîne de publication adaptée au portail généré.

Eleventy Workflow GitHub Pages
17 mars 2026

64580b8 — Extension du .gitignore

Nettoyage du dépôt avec l’ajout d’ignorés courants pour éviter de versionner des fichiers parasites liés au build ou à l’environnement local.

.gitignore Nettoyage Build
17 mars 2026

9853999 — Refonte du README pour le portail Eleventy

Mise à jour de la documentation du dépôt pour refléter la nouvelle architecture, le pipeline de build et le mode de déploiement.

README Documentation Eleventy
17 mars 2026

2376ac2 — Désactivation du moteur Markdown

Ajustement de la configuration pour éviter les rendus incorrects et mieux contrôler la génération des pages dans le contexte Eleventy.

Markdown Configuration Rendu
17 mars 2026

6675ef4 — Nettoyage de la configuration Eleventy

Réduction du nombre de tags affichés et simplification de la configuration pour améliorer la lisibilité et la cohérence du rendu.

Eleventy Tags Configuration
17 mars 2026

be4491b / f69f952 / 0d3a8a0 — Itérations sur le déploiement

Corrections de workflow, refactor du déploiement GitHub Actions pour Pages et ajustements mineurs sur le fichier deploy-pages.yml.

Workflow GitHub Actions Déploiement
17 mars 2026

4875aaa / 2a53c98 — Itérations sur CNAME

Création puis suppression du fichier CNAME dans le cadre des ajustements autour du domaine personnalisé et du mode de publication GitHub Pages.

CNAME Domaine personnalisé GitHub Pages
19 mars 2026

bd32cab / 8676222 — Réécriture puis refactor du changelog

Le changelog a d’abord été réécrit dans un style proche du Markdown, puis restructuré en HTML afin de mieux s’intégrer au layout et au rendu du portail Eleventy.

Changelog HTML Refactor
22 mars 2026

e058084 — Correction du contexte des macros du changelog

Import des macros avec with context afin de permettre à commitItem d’accéder correctement à site.repoUrl et de générer des liens GitHub valides.

Nunjucks Macros Changelog Bugfix